of their state-of-the-art metal printing systems. As a Principal Software Engineer, you will play a pivotal role in the development of embedded software for the company's next-generation 3D metal printing machines. These machines are designed to deliver high-volume, precision printing for large-scale … industrial parts, with an emphasis on sustainability and green manufacturing. You will be responsible for architecting and implementing software solutions that integrate motion control systems, real-time operating systems (RTOS), and other critical embedded components to ensure the efficient and reliable performance of the printing systems. In … that software and hardware integration meets the high standards required for large-scale manufacturing environments. Key Responsibilities: Lead the architecture, design, and development of embedded software for large-scale 3D metal printing machines, focusing on motion control systems, real-time performance, and machine functionality. Develop and maintain high More ❯
go bigger, including: Strong experience managing and growing software engineering teams at pace – ideally in high-tech or research-driven environments. A background in embeddedsystems, compilers, complex systems or other deep tech areas. A people-first approach to leadership – you're passionate about coaching, career progression More ❯
Embedded Software Engineer | £35-50k | Reading | Scientific Instrumentation Join a world leader in scientific instrumentation, designing high-precision instruments. Due to continued growth, theyre looking for a passionate Embedded Software Engineer with a hands-on approach to engineering. This role offers the opportunity to expand into electronics … and mechanical engineering with full training provided. Key Responsibilities: + Embedded Software Development Writing, testing & debugging software for scientific instrumentation & data recorders. + Electronics & PCB Design Designing circuits, selecting components, and developing embedded systems. + Software Tools & Analytics Developing in-house solutions for testing & manufacturing. + Customer Support … Assistance Helping resolve software-related issues. Essential Skills & Experience: + Degree in Electronics, Computer Science, Mechanical Engineering, or Physics + Hands-on experience with embedded C/C++ + Strong mathematical & analytical skills + Enthusiasm for engineering & personal projects Bonus Skills (Nice to Have): + Experience with Qt development More ❯